| MUSTANGBOY's SPECIAL OPS BUILD
Ok after nationals and seeing this chassis work I wanted one , so Nick @ T1E hooked me up with a "SPECIAL OPS" chassis and some TI lower links .Here are some pictures and parts so far on the rig ....... full drooped out @12.5" thanks Nick for the lower links ...DEAD on LINKS they should be called thanks to my GOOD buddy "FARMER" ,he got my 31mm SUPERSHAFTY VELVET shocks turned down for me ....49 grams w/ 17.5wt oil total for the set ... and thanks to Rick @ SUPERSHSHAFTY.COM for supporting me on my journeys Next up are some "Evil Crawler Design" 3pc carbon fiber rims glued to a set of Losi boss claws clapped out ... Thanks EvilTwin for the Awesome product Little bit of RowdyRacing on the under side ...Great product And for the "POWER PLANT" for this rig are some Br00D 40t "STUBBY" motors i won at nationals ... Got to give a HUGE thanks to EDDIEO @ Br00d for the motors and for sponsoring the little guy on the block some action shots from yesterdays comp ...more to come the RTR weight of the rig is 4.056lbs w/out the gears drilled out ...soon to be next ...
